Cajun Salmon and Shrimp with Garlic Butter Sauce

Ingredients:
For the Cajun Salmon and Shrimp:

2 salmon fillets
1 lb large shrimp, peeled and deveined
2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ning
1 tablespoon olive oil
Salt and pepper to taste
1 tablespoon lemon juice
For the Garlic Butter Sauce:

4 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 teaspoon lemon zest
1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ional for extra heat)
Instructions:
Prepare the Salmon and Shrimp:
In a bowl, toss the salmon fillets and shrimp with Cajun seasoning, olive oil, salt, pepper, and lemon juice until well coated.
Cook the Salmon and Shrimp:
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Add the salmon fillets skin-side down and cook for about 4-5 minutes. Carefully flip and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es, or until cooked through and flaky.
Remove the salmon from the skillet and set aside.
In the same skillet, add the shrimp and c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they turn pink and opaque. Remove from heat.
Make the Garlic Butter Sauce:
In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the unsalted butter. Once melted, add the min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
Stir in the lemon zest, chopped parsley, and red pepper flakes (if using). Cook for an additional minute.
Serve:
Plate the Cajun salmon and shrimp, and drizzle the garlic butter sauce over the top. Garnish with extra parsley if desired.
